What are the differences between the natures of dc flux and ac flux?

dc flux is caused by dc current (flux and current are proportional), it is a constant value. Put an inductor (or transformer winding) across a battery and you will get dc flux. ac flux is caused by ac current (flux and current are proportional), it is a moving value, the flux moves with the current, typically cyclical but the waveform is arbitrary as long as we're moving.

Why a double coil transformer does not work on a pure DC voltage source?

According to Faraday's Law only if there is change in flux linkage of a conductor then current is induced between mutual inductors. Now DC will induce a constant a constant flux in the transformer core, consequently in the secondary coil. So constant flux cannot induce a current in the secondary. SUBHRA JYOTI SAHA

Why transformer is called constant flux machine?

when a load is connected to a transformer current(say I2) flows through secondary coil thus an M.M.F (N2I2) is produced ,this produces the secondary flux. This flux reduces the the main flux induced in the primary & also reduces E.M.F E1 in the primary As a result more current is drawn from the supply. This additional current drawn is due to the load component(say I2' ) This I2' is anti-phase with I2.This I2' sets a flux which opposes the secondary flux & helps the main flux. The load component flux neutralises the secondary flux produced by I2 .The M.M.F N1I2' balances N2I2.Thus the net flux is always at constant level. As practically flux is constant,the core loss is constant for all loads. Hence a transformer is always called a Constant Flux Machine.
